Overview
Situated in Olt, Romania, Zorleasca is a small village. Zorleasca maps to 44.420°, 24.460° — squarely within the temperate belt. Census-style estimates put the resident count near 425. The location receives about 1,404 kWh/m² of solar irradiance per year and sunshine for roughly 55% of daylight hours. Long-term weather observations show average highs near 64.3°F and lows near 47.1°F with about 24.5 in of annual precipitation (a relatively dry total). Its latitude implies a climate characterised by four distinct seasons with warm summers and cold winters.
